Uttara Bhadrapada is the twenty-sixth nakshatra, ruled by Saturn and devoted to Ahir Budhnya, the serpent of the deep. Where the Moon here holds depth calmly, Mars here drives with a steady, enduring force — the will that goes deep and remains whole.

The Mansion Itself

Uttara Bhadrapada is devoted to Ahir Budhnya, the serpent of the deep waters, who dwells beneath the world and knows its hidden currents, and its symbol is the back legs of the funeral cot — the steady support that carries the soul home. Its classical power is the gift of steadiness at the end: the ability to remain whole when everything around you is ending, to carry others through the dark, to finish with grace. Its yogatara is Algenib in Pegasus, the star that marks the corner of the Great Square — a quiet, unshakable anchor in the sky. Mars rules the fourth of the nine periods in the Vimśottarī Daśā system, and its period lasts seven years — a stretch of life defined by drive, ambition, conflict, and decisive action. How to Find This in Your Chart

  1. Find your Mars's degree in your natal report — for example, "Mars 9° 30' Pisces."
  2. Check the Mars in the 27 Lunar Mansions overview to confirm which mansion covers that degree.
  3. Uttara Bhadrapada spans from 3 degrees 20 minutes to 16 degrees 40 minutes of Pisces — if your Mars falls there, these themes describe your drive.
  4. Note that Uttara Bhadrapada is ruled by Saturn, so read your Saturn placement as a flavor on top of your Mars sign.
